Package org.apache.http.protocol

Examples of org.apache.http.protocol.UriHttpRequestHandlerMapper


            final HttpResponseFactory responseFactory,
            final HttpExpectationVerifier expectationVerifier,
            final SSLContext sslcontext,
            final boolean forceSSLAuth) {
        super();
        this.handlerRegistry = new UriHttpRequestHandlerMapper();
        this.workers = Collections.synchronizedSet(new HashSet<Worker>());
        this.httpservice = new HttpService(
            proc != null ? proc : newProcessor(),
            reuseStrat != null ? reuseStrat: newConnectionReuseStrategy(),
            responseFactory != null ? responseFactory: newHttpResponseFactory(),
View Full Code Here


            final HttpResponseFactory responseFactory,
            final HttpExpectationVerifier expectationVerifier,
            final SSLContext sslcontext,
            final boolean forceSSLAuth) {
        super();
        this.handlerRegistry = new UriHttpRequestHandlerMapper();
        this.workers = Collections.synchronizedSet(new HashSet<Worker>());
        this.httpservice = new HttpService(
            proc != null ? proc : newProcessor(),
            reuseStrat != null ? reuseStrat: newConnectionReuseStrategy(),
            responseFactory != null ? responseFactory: newHttpResponseFactory(),
View Full Code Here

            final ConnectionReuseStrategy reuseStrat,
            final HttpResponseFactory responseFactory,
            final HttpExpectationVerifier expectationVerifier,
            final SSLContext sslcontext) {
        super();
        this.handlerRegistry = new UriHttpRequestHandlerMapper();
        this.workers = Collections.synchronizedSet(new HashSet<Worker>());
        this.httpservice = new HttpService(
            proc != null ? proc : newProcessor(),
            reuseStrat != null ? reuseStrat: newConnectionReuseStrategy(),
            responseFactory != null ? responseFactory: newHttpResponseFactory(),
View Full Code Here

    private volatile org.apache.http.impl.bootstrap.HttpServer server;

    public HttpServer() throws IOException {
        super();
        this.reqistry = new UriHttpRequestHandlerMapper();
    }
View Full Code Here

            httpProcessorCopy = b.build();
        }

        HttpRequestHandlerMapper handlerMapperCopy = this.handlerMapper;
        if (handlerMapperCopy == null) {
            final UriHttpRequestHandlerMapper reqistry = new UriHttpRequestHandlerMapper();
            if (handlerMap != null) {
                for (Map.Entry<String, HttpRequestHandler> entry: handlerMap.entrySet()) {
                    reqistry.register(entry.getKey(), entry.getValue());
                }
            }
            handlerMapperCopy = reqistry;
        }
View Full Code Here

                        new ResponseDate(),
                        new ResponseServer("TEST-SERVER/1.1"),
                        new ResponseContent(),
                        new ResponseConnControl()
                });
        this.reqistry = new UriHttpRequestHandlerMapper();
        this.serversocket = new ServerSocket(0);
    }
View Full Code Here

            httpProcessorCopy = b.build();
        }

        HttpRequestHandlerMapper handlerMapperCopy = this.handlerMapper;
        if (handlerMapperCopy == null) {
            final UriHttpRequestHandlerMapper reqistry = new UriHttpRequestHandlerMapper();
            if (handlerMap != null) {
                for (Map.Entry<String, HttpRequestHandler> entry: handlerMap.entrySet()) {
                    reqistry.register(entry.getKey(), entry.getValue());
                }
            }
            handlerMapperCopy = reqistry;
        }
View Full Code Here

                .add(new ResponseServer("Test/1.1"))
                .add(new ResponseContent())
                .add(new ResponseConnControl()).build();

            // Set up request handlers
            UriHttpRequestHandlerMapper reqistry = new UriHttpRequestHandlerMapper();
            reqistry.register("*", new HttpFileHandler(docroot));

            // Set up the HTTP service
            this.httpService = new HttpService(httpproc, reqistry);
        }
View Full Code Here

            final HttpResponseFactory responseFactory,
            final HttpExpectationVerifier expectationVerifier,
            final SSLContext sslcontext,
            final boolean forceSSLAuth) {
        super();
        this.handlerRegistry = new UriHttpRequestHandlerMapper();
        this.workers = Collections.synchronizedSet(new HashSet<Worker>());
        this.httpservice = new HttpService(
            proc != null ? proc : newProcessor(),
            reuseStrat != null ? reuseStrat: newConnectionReuseStrategy(),
            responseFactory != null ? responseFactory: newHttpResponseFactory(),
View Full Code Here

        }
    }

    @Test(expected=ClientProtocolException.class)
    public void testRejectInvalidRedirectLocation() throws Exception {
        final UriHttpRequestHandlerMapper reqistry = new UriHttpRequestHandlerMapper();
        this.serverBootstrap.setHandlerMapper(reqistry);

        final HttpHost target = start();

        reqistry.register("*",
                new BogusRedirectService("http://" + target.toHostString() +
                        "/newlocation/?p=I have spaces"));

        final HttpGet httpget = new HttpGet("/oldlocation/");

View Full Code Here

TOP

Related Classes of org.apache.http.protocol.UriHttpRequestHandlerMapper

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.